Output 77d0ab995df31f95942c6ced0028db6e7625fd71f5051523bac2f099615b5090:0

value
10161961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f53dfb1c44786997d6d2c3dedc56db1f762490d OP_EQUAL
address
3Eks2dUf9zAzZWKG5T7TmkGgVBtpYKPpQE
transaction
77d0ab995df31f95942c6ced0028db6e7625fd71f5051523bac2f099615b5090
confirmations
332441
spent
true